Giloy, a medicinal plant packed with health-boosting compounds, has stepped into the spotlight—not for its leaves alone, but for its stems too. Researchers used ultrasound, a green extraction technology, to pull out bioactive treasures from both parts. They optimized the process using a central composite rotatable design and response surface methodology, tweaking the solvent-to-solid ratio, sonication time, and solvent concentration to maximize antioxidant activity, total phenolic content, and yield. The sweet spot? A ratio of 22.5:1, 40 minutes of sonication, and 75% solvent concentration. Under these conditions, the extracts didn't just pack a punch in the lab—they also inhibited the growth of harmful bacteria like S. aureus and E. coli. Liquid chromatography-mass spectrometry revealed a cocktail of significant polyphenols, including catechin, quercetin, kaempferol, ellagic acid, hesperidin, and berberine, along with malic acid. These findings suggest that ultrasonication is not only effective but also eco-friendly, making giloy a promising functional ingredient for tasty, long-lasting food and beverages.
